The legislative basis for the Water Conservation Grant scheme is set out in Section 5 of the Water Services Act 2014 and statutory regulations under the section, inter alia, provide for the general administrative procedures for the scheme.

Persons who registered with Irish Water, as required under Section 5(2)(a) of the Water Services Act 2014, on or before 30 June 2015, were eligible to receive the grant in 2015, in respect of their principal private residence only.

As at the 30 June 2015, a total of 1.308m households had registered with Irish Water and were therefore eligible to apply for the 2015 Water Conservation Grant. To date, 887,127 have applied for and have received the grant.
